I love to create spaces to explore and navigate the emotional and collective complexity of the polycrisis. I am a co-founder and member of the Urban Heat Studio and a postdoctoral researcher at die Angewandte, Vienna. Drawing on 15+ years across climate, systems, futures, design and art, I specialize in translating abstract social and ecological change into tangible, embodied experiences.I help organizations and communities navigate overlapping crises around the climate crisis. I help them explore long-term risks and adaptation measures that require time to build. I bring people together to prototype futures through immersive theater and experiential scenarios, uncovering emotional responses. I prioritize establishing trust and creating space for playfulness. Serious projects require play, and I take play very seriously – on each project, I like to first gather the right playteam, and set up our playground. I thrive in collective, co-creative environments that value flexible hierarchies, interdependence and open communication.Along with Francesca Desmarais, I co-founded Urban Heat Studio, an imagination collective for transformative climate adaptation. We gather people together to break down the time barriers between climate impacts tomorrow and the structures and injustices today that make us brittle in the face of planetary-wide change. In our work, we seek out gracious emergence, being extraordinary unconventional, and doing our best work.Since 2021, I've hosted HeatCon, an annual gathering to envision and embody radically resilient climate futures for European cities. This seriously playful approach brings climate scenarios to life through immersive experiences, allowing participants to explore climate futures from 30-50 years ahead while identifying the mindset shifts and actions needed today.As a performer, I do standup and play improv comedy with three teams: Daisy Chain, We Got it On Tape, and the newest House Team at the Comedy Cafe Berlin, set to premiere in early 2026.
